Customers already being urged to conserve water to avoid a repeat of last year when £228k was spent replenishing remote island reservoir

Posted on May 2, 2026 by sakana1

Scottish Water has given advice on how to save water during the summer after last year’s dry heat saw a £222,828 job to refill the Skerries reservoir.
